AAAR, Tamil Nadu: INOX Cannot Utilise ITC of GST Restricted u/s 17 (5) (d) - (19 Jan 2022)

GOODS AND SERVICES TAX

Appellate Authority of Advance Ruling (AAAR) Tamil Nadu while upholding the Authority of Advance Ruling’s Order has held that INOX cannot utilise Input Tax Credit (ITC) of Goods and Services Tax restricted under Section 17(5)(d) charged by IPL.
